It's 2:00 AM in the morning and your (late-ass) flight has just arrived in O'Hare. Your phone died somewhere above Tulsa, but you desperately need a charge so that you can find your hotel and do a dozen other things. You only have four or five minutes before your baggage arrives but, since you have a Freeplay ZipCharge, that's more than enough time.
SlashGear reports that this £49.95 gadget is capable of recharging an iPod entirely off of a 15-minute charge. If you charge for only a minute, you can grab another two hours. The Freeplay ZipCharge works in wall outlets or a DC car adapter. It has tips for Nokia, Blackberry, iPhone, HTC, LG, Samsung, Motorola and Ericsson products.
